The Inventory Forecasting Formula That Stops Stockouts Before They Happen
Learn how to automate inventory forecasting on Shopify. Master the formula for lead time demand and safety stock to prevent stockouts and boost ROI.
Vigor

The Inventory Forecasting Formula That Stops Stockouts Before They Happen
For most Shopify store owners, inventory management is a source of constant anxiety. On one hand, you have the nightmare of the stockout: a customer lands on your site, ready to buy, only to see the dreaded "Sold Out" badge. You lose the sale, you lose the customer, and your acquisition cost (CAC) goes straight to zero ROI.
On the other hand, there is overstocking. Dead capital sitting on warehouse shelves, slowly eating your margins through storage fees and eventual liquidation.
In 2026, manual spreadsheets are no longer enough to manage this balance. The solution lies in inventory forecasting automation. By applying a few core mathematical formulas and letting AI agents handle the data crunching, you can predict exactly when to reorder, how much to buy, and how to protect your cash flow.
TL;DR: Why Automate Your Inventory?
- Prevent Stockouts: Never miss a sale during peak demand again.
- Optimize Cash Flow: Stop tying up thousands in slow-moving SKUs.
- Save Time: Eliminate the 5-10 hours a week spent on manual Excel forecasting.
- Scale Smarter: Automate reorder triggers so you can focus on marketing, not math.
The Core Problem: The "Human Error" Profit Leak
Most founders use "vibe-based forecasting." They look at last month's sales, add a little cushion, and hope for the best. This fails because it ignores two critical variables: Lead Time Volatility and Safety Stock Buffers.
When your lead time (the time from placing an order to receiving it) fluctuates from 14 days to 21 days, a "vibe-based" reorder point will fail 100% of the time. Automation removes the guesswork by calculating these metrics in real-time.
| Metric | Manual Method | Automated Method (BiClaw) |
|---|---|---|
| Data Source | Exported CSVs (stale) | Live Shopify + ShipStation Sync |
| Demand Calculation | Monthly average | Daily Sales Velocity (DSV) |
| Buffer | "A few extra boxes" | Statistical Safety Stock Formula |
| Action | Remembering to email supplier | Auto-generated purchase order |
The Golden Formula for Inventory Forecasting
To automate your stock levels, you must master the Reorder Point (ROP) Formula. This is the heart of any inventory forecasting automation system.
1. Lead Time Demand (LTD)
This is the amount of stock you will sell while waiting for your new shipment to arrive.
Formula: Average Daily Sales × Lead Time (in Days) = LTD
Example: If you sell 20 units a day and your supplier takes 15 days to deliver, your LTD is 300 units. If you have less than 300 units when you order, you will go out of stock before the truck arrives.
2. Safety Stock (The "Insurance Policy")
Safety stock protects you against sudden spikes in demand or supplier delays.
Formula: (Max Daily Sales × Max Lead Time) - (Avg Daily Sales × Avg Lead Time) = Safety Stock
3. The Final Reorder Point (ROP)
This is the "Trigger" for your automation. When your inventory hits this number, the system alerts you (or your supplier) immediately.
Formula: Lead Time Demand + Safety Stock = Reorder Point
Why Qualitative vs. Quantitative Forecasting Matters
As noted in the official Shopify guide to inventory forecasting, there are two primary schools of thought:
- Quantitative Forecasting: This uses historical numerical data. It is highly accurate for established stores with at least two years of data.
- Qualitative Forecasting: This relies on market research, focus groups, and expert opinion. This is essential for new product launches where no historical data exists.
For automation, we prioritize Demand-Driven Forecasting. This approach uses real-time data from your Point of Sale (POS) to adjust forecasts instantly. If a TikTok influencer mentions your product and sales spike 400% in 3 hours, a demand-driven system will update your Reorder Point before you even wake up.
Step-by-Step Guide to Automating Your Shopify Forecast
Step 1: Connect Your Data Streams
Automation only works with clean data. You need a 360-degree view that includes:
- Sales Velocity: Not just total sales, but daily sales velocity per SKU.
- Marketing Calendar: If you’re running a Facebook Ads campaign, your forecast must increase accordingly.
- Supplier Benchmarks: Track the actual time it takes for your supplier to deliver, not just the "promised" lead time.
Step 2: Implement Statistical Safety Stock
Don't just add 20% to every order. High-margin, high-velocity items need a higher safety stock "Service Level" (e.g., 98% stock availability), while slow-moving accessories can afford a lower buffer. AI agents can dynamically adjust these buffers based on business intelligence reports.
Step 3: Set Up Automated Reorder Triggers
In a modern agentic workflow, you don't check a dashboard to see what's low. Your AI assistant monitors the ROP for every SKU. When a threshold is crossed, the agent:
- Calculates the optimal order quantity.
- Checks the current bank balance.
- Drafts a Purchase Order (PO) and sends it to your Slack or Telegram for one-click approval.
Advanced Strategies: Seasonal and Trend Analysis
Beyond the basic ROP formula, automated systems must account for Seasonality. Selling pool floats in July is different from selling them in December. Time-series forecasting organizes data points based on the time of year to predict these cycles.
Furthermore, Trend Forecasting analyzes broad cultural shifts. If there is a sudden push for organic or eco-friendly products, an automated system can flag these shifts by scanning competitor monitoring tools and adjusting your inventory strategy before the market shifts entirely.
Mini-Case Study: How 'Everlast Supplements' Saved $4k/Mo
A mid-sized Shopify store, Everlast Supplements, was struggling with seasonal stockouts of their flagship protein powder. By switching from manual spreadsheets to an automated ROP system:
- Reduction in Stockouts: 88% in the first quarter.
- Cash Flow Unlocked: They identified $15,000 in overstocked slow-moving SKUs.
- Result: The freed-up cash was reinvested into marketing automation tools, leading to a 22% revenue lift.
Troubleshooting Your Forecast
Common mistakes in automation include:
- Ignoring Marketing Variables: If you run a Shopify email marketing campaign but don't tell your forecasting tool, you'll sell out.
- Stale Lead Times: Suppliers change. Always verify lead times quarterly.
- Inaccurate Returns Data: Ensure your system accounts for returns, which "re-stock" your inventory.
Related Reading
- How We Run Growth Ops at BiClaw: AI Agents Doing the Work
- The 2026 Guide to AI Agents for Business Automation
- SOP to Autopilot: Automating Operations with AI
Conclusion: Data is Your Competitive Advantage
In the hyper-competitive world of e-commerce, the winner isn't always the one with the best product; it's the one with the most efficient supply chain. By implementing inventory forecasting automation, you turn a logistical headache into a predictable profit engine.
Stop guessing. Start calculating. Let the agents handle the rest.
Ready to automate your Shopify reporting and inventory triggers? Try BiClaw for 7 days.


